How often do garage door rollers need replacement in Houston?

Garage door rollers in Houston typically last between 5 to 10 years. Factors like frequency of use and exposure to humidity can affect their lifespan. Worn rollers can cause noisy operation and damage tracks. A pro can inspect them during a routine service. They'll replace them if they show signs of wear.

What are the pros and cons of wood garage doors in Houston?

Wood garage doors offer a classic, attractive look for Houston residences. However, they require more maintenance than other materials due to humidity and potential warping. Pros can advise on proper sealing and finishing to extend their life. They'll also discuss the weight implications for your opener. This ensures you understand the commitment.

Why are my garage door sensors not working in Houston?

Garage door sensors in Houston can malfunction due to misalignment, dirt, or damage. A technician will check their alignment and clean them thoroughly. They'll also inspect the wiring and the sensors themselves for any physical damage. If a sensor is faulty, it will be replaced. This restores proper safety functionality.
